Statement-1 : A charged particle is moving in a circular path with constant speed in uniform magnetic field .If we increase the speed of the particle three times its acceleration will become nine times.
Statement-2 : In a circular path with constant speed, acceleration is given by \(\frac{\mathrm{v}^{2}}{\mathrm{R}}\).
  1. Statement–1 is True, Statement–2 is True; Statement–2 is a correct explanation for Statement–1 .
  2. Statement–1 is true, Statement–2 is True; Statement–2 is NOT a correct explanation for Statement–1 .
  3. Statement–1 is True; Statement–2 is False.
  4. Statement–1 is False, Statement–2 is True.

Answer

(D) Statement–1 is False, Statement–2 is True.
